Stephen Pless receives Medal of Honor
|
http://www.popasmoke.com/video/pless.wmv The President of the United States takes pleasure in presenting the MEDAL OF HONOR to: MAJOR STEPHEN W. PLESS UNITED STATES MARINE CORPS for service as set forth in the following
CITATION:
For conspicuous gallantry and intrepidity at the risk of his life above and beyond the call of duty while serving as a helicopter gunship pilot attached to Marine Observation Squadron Six in action against enemy forces near Quang Ngai, Republic of Vietnam, on 19 August 1967. |
